Understanding Modern Laptop Viruses

Before creating a security strategy, it’s important to understand the threats you’re defending against.

Traditional Viruses

Traditional viruses attach themselves to legitimate files and spread when users open infected programs or documents.

They can:

  • Corrupt files
  • Slow performance
  • Cause system instability

Ransomware

Ransomware encrypts your files and demands payment for recovery.

Modern ransomware attacks can:

  • Lock entire systems
  • Encrypt cloud backups
  • Target businesses and individuals

Spyware

Spyware secretly monitors user activity and collects information such as:

  • Passwords
  • Banking details
  • Browsing habits
  • Personal data

Trojans

Trojans disguise themselves as legitimate software.

Once installed, they can:

  • Create backdoors
  • Steal information
  • Download additional malware

AI-Powered Malware

One of the newest threats in 2026 is AI-enhanced malware.

These threats can:

  • Adapt to security defenses
  • Avoid detection
  • Automatically spread through networks

This makes a layered security strategy more important than ever.

Step 1: Keep Your Operating System Updated

The foundation of laptop security starts with keeping your operating system current.

Software updates often include:

  • Security patches
  • Vulnerability fixes
  • Malware protection improvements

Enable automatic updates for:

  • Windows
  • macOS
  • System drivers

Many cyberattacks target known vulnerabilities that have already been patched.

Failing to update your system leaves your laptop exposed.

Step 2: Install Reliable Antivirus Protection

Antivirus software remains one of the most important security tools in 2026.

A modern antivirus solution should provide:

  • Real-time protection
  • Malware detection
  • Ransomware protection
  • Web security monitoring
  • Email scanning

Schedule regular scans and ensure virus definitions update automatically.

Antivirus software should be considered the first line of defense, not the only line of defense.

Step 3: Enable Advanced Firewall Protection

A firewall monitors incoming and outgoing network traffic.

It helps block:

  • Unauthorized access attempts
  • Suspicious connections
  • Malware communications

Most operating systems include built-in firewalls.

Verify that your firewall is active and properly configured.

For business users, advanced firewall solutions can provide additional protection.

Step 4: Use Strong Password Management

Weak passwords remain one of the leading causes of security breaches.

A secure password should:

  • Be at least 12 to 16 characters long
  • Include uppercase letters
  • Include lowercase letters
  • Include numbers
  • Include special characters

Avoid using:

  • Names
  • Birthdays
  • Common words
  • Repeated passwords

Each account should have a unique password.

Step 5: Enable Multi-Factor Authentication (MFA)

Multi-factor authentication adds an additional security layer.

Even if someone obtains your password, they still need:

  • Authentication app approval
  • Security key verification
  • One-time access code

Enable MFA for:

  • Email accounts
  • Banking apps
  • Cloud storage
  • Social media
  • Business platforms

This significantly reduces unauthorized access risks.

Step 6: Secure Your Web Browser

Web browsers are common targets for cybercriminals.

To improve browser security:

Update Regularly

Always use the latest browser version.

Remove Unnecessary Extensions

Extensions can introduce vulnerabilities.

Only install trusted browser add-ons.

Block Pop-Ups

Malicious pop-ups often distribute malware.

Enable built-in pop-up blockers.

Use Safe Browsing Features

Most modern browsers include phishing and malware protection.

Activate all available security settings.

Step 7: Create a Safe Download Policy

Many virus infections occur because users download unsafe files.

Only download software from trusted sources.

Avoid:

  • Cracked software
  • Pirated applications
  • Unknown websites
  • Suspicious email attachments

Before opening any downloaded file:

  • Scan it with antivirus software
  • Verify the source
  • Check file authenticity

Step 8: Protect Your Email Accounts

Email remains one of the primary delivery methods for malware.

Common threats include:

  • Phishing emails
  • Malicious attachments
  • Fake invoices
  • Fraudulent login requests

Protect yourself by:

  • Verifying senders
  • Avoiding suspicious links
  • Scanning attachments
  • Using email security filters

Never provide passwords through email.

Step 9: Secure Your Home Wi-Fi Network

An unsecured network can expose your laptop to threats.

To secure your Wi-Fi:

Use WPA3 Encryption

Modern encryption standards provide stronger protection.

Change Default Router Passwords

Many routers ship with easily guessed credentials.

Update Router Firmware

Firmware updates often include security fixes.

Disable Unnecessary Features

Turn off features you don’t use to reduce attack surfaces.

Step 10: Regularly Backup Important Data

Even the best security strategy cannot guarantee complete protection.

Backups ensure your data remains recoverable.

Follow the 3-2-1 Backup Rule:

  • 3 copies of your data
  • 2 different storage methods
  • 1 off-site backup

Backup options include:

  • External hard drives
  • Cloud storage
  • Network storage devices

Regular backups are your best defense against ransomware.

Step 11: Encrypt Sensitive Information

Encryption protects your files even if your laptop is lost or stolen.

Benefits include:

  • Data privacy
  • Theft protection
  • Compliance support
  • Secure business information

Most modern operating systems include built-in encryption tools.

Enable full-disk encryption whenever possible.

Step 12: Monitor for Security Threats

Early detection is critical.

Watch for warning signs such as:

  • Slow performance
  • Unexpected pop-ups
  • Browser redirects
  • Unknown applications
  • Frequent crashes
  • Unusual network activity

The sooner threats are identified, the easier they are to remove.

Step 13: Train Yourself Against Social Engineering

Cybercriminals increasingly target people instead of systems.

Social engineering attacks manipulate users into revealing information.

Examples include:

  • Fake support calls
  • Fraudulent emails
  • Impersonation scams
  • Deepfake communications

Always verify requests before sharing information.

Step 14: Develop a Security Maintenance Schedule

Laptop security requires ongoing maintenance.

Weekly Tasks:

  • Run antivirus scans
  • Check software updates
  • Review downloads

Monthly Tasks:

  • Backup important files
  • Review account security
  • Remove unnecessary software

Quarterly Tasks:

  • Change critical passwords
  • Review security settings
  • Audit installed applications

Consistency is key to long-term protection.

Step 15: Create an Emergency Response Plan

Every laptop user should know what to do if an infection occurs.

If you suspect a virus:

  1. Disconnect from the internet.
  2. Run a full security scan.
  3. Back up critical files if safe.
  4. Remove suspicious software.
  5. Change passwords.
  6. Monitor financial accounts.
  7. Seek professional assistance if necessary.

Quick action can minimize damage.

Frequently Asked Questions (FAQs)

  1. What is the most effective way to prevent laptop viruses in 2026?

Answer:

The most effective approach is a layered security strategy that includes antivirus software, system updates, strong passwords, multi-factor authentication, secure browsing habits, and regular backups.

  1. How often should I scan my laptop for viruses?

Answer:

You should enable real-time protection and perform a full system scan at least once per week. Additional scans are recommended after downloading files or clicking suspicious links.

  1. Can antivirus software stop all viruses?

Answer:

No. While antivirus software provides strong protection, no solution can guarantee 100% security. Combining antivirus protection with safe online behavior offers the best defense.

  1. Why are software updates important for laptop security?

Answer:

Updates fix security vulnerabilities that cybercriminals may exploit. Keeping your operating system and applications updated helps protect against the latest threats.

  1. What should I do if my laptop becomes infected with a virus?

Answer:

Disconnect from the internet immediately, run a full antivirus scan, remove suspicious software, change passwords, restore files from backups if necessary, and seek professional IT support if the issue persists.
